Gareth Mackin comes into the Armagh side for Wednesday's Ulster U21FC semi-final versus Tyrone at Brewster Park (throw-in 8pm).

Mackin - a substitute in the 2-13 to 1-5 quarter-final victory over Antrim - replaces Niall Grimley in Steven McDonnell's starting fifteen, lining out at right half forward.

Armagh (U21FC v Tyrone) - Blaine Hughes; Gregory McCabe, Shea Heffron, Jamie Cosgrove; Fionnan Burns, Donal O'Neill, Daniel Nugent; Ciaron O'Hanlon, Ethan Rafferty; Gareth Mackin, Callum Comiskey, Connaire Mackin; Aidan Nugent, Cathal McKenna, Ryan McShane.

Subs: Ryan Gilmore, Peter Campbell, Michael Murphy, Sean Connell, Jack Grugan, Niall Grimley, Conor Martin, Aaron McKay, Blaine Malone.
